상식닷컴
로그인
가입하기
2026년 상식닷컴 선정 식당 & 카페 리스트
2025년 2026년 신상 호텔 리스트
최근에 오픈한 호텔을 찾는다면 살펴보세요
일주일 식단표 어플
자동 일주일 식단표 어플
안드로이드
아이폰
주식 & 코인 차트의 신
1000만원으로 2000만원 만들기 프로젝트
수정하기 - 가상 메모리의 최적화 방안은 무엇인가요?
닉네임
비밀번호
제목
내용
[이미지 업로드는 권한이 있는 사람만 가능. 하단 카톡으로 연락]
가상 메모리의 최적화는 시스템의 성능을 크게 향상시킬 수 있습니다. 아래는 가상 메모리 최적화를 위한 몇 가지 방안입니다. 1. 페이지 <a href='https://sangseek.com/sangseeks/크기 조정/ko'>크기 조정</a> : - 페이지 크기를 적절히 조정하여 <a href='https://sangseek.com/sangseeks/TLB/ko'>TLB</a>(Translation Lookaside Buffer)의 효율성을 높일 수 있습니다. 작은 페이지 크기는 내부 단편화를 줄일 수 있지만, 페이지 테이블의 크기가 증가하므로 균형을 맞춰야 합니다. 2. 페이지 교체 알고리즘 개선 : - LRU(Least Recently Used), LFU(Least Frequently Used), 최적 페이지 교체(Optimal Page Replacement)와 같은 효율적인 페이지 교체 알고리즘을 사용하여 페이지 부재를 줄이는 것이 중요합니다. 3. 프리페칭(pre-fetching) : - 미래에 사용할 가능성이 높은 페이지를 미리 메모리에 로드함으로써 디스크 접근을 최소화하고 성능을 향상시킬 수 있습니다. 4. 메모리 풀 사용 : - 자주 사용되는 객체나 데이터를 위한 메모리 풀을 설정하여 할당과 해제를 최적화하고 내부 단편화를 최소화할 수 있습니다. 5. 프로세스 적재 최적화 : - 프로세스를 동적으로 적재하고 필요한 페이지만 메모리에 로드하는 방식으로 초기 메모리 사용량을 줄이고, 필요한 경우에만 페이지를 추가로 로드하는 방식으로 메모리를 효율적으로 사용할 수 있습니다. 6. 메모리 아키텍처의 개선 : - NUMA(Non-Uniform Memory Access) 아키텍처와 같은 현대적 메모리 구조를 활용하여 다중 프로세서 시스템에서 각 프로세서의 접근 시간을 최적화할 수 있습니다. 7. 메모리 사용 모니터링 및 튜닝 : - 시스템의 메모리 사용 패턴을 모니터링하고, 이를 분석하여 <a href='https://sangseek.com/sangseeks/메모리 할당/ko'>메모리 할당</a> 및 페이지 교체 전략을 조정함으로써 성능을 향상시킬 수 있습니다. 8. 가상 메모리 아키텍처 최적화 : - 커널이나 사용자 공간의 가상 메모리 매핑 최적화를 통해 메모리 접근 성능을 높이는 방법도 있습니다. 이러한 최적화 방안을 통해 가상 메모리 시스템의 성능을 개선할 수 있으며, 결과적으로 시스템 전체의 효율성과 반응성을 높일 수 있습니다.
이용안내
커뮤니티 이용안내
×
- 게시한 게시글로 발생하는 문제는 게시자에게 책임이 있습니다.
- 게시글이 타인/타업체의 저작권을 침해할 경우 모든 책임은 게시자에게 있습니다. 게시자가 모든 손해를 부담해야 합니다.
- 상식닷컴 운영자는 게시자와 상의하지 않고 게시글을 수정 또는 삭제할 수 있습니다.
- 상식닷컴 운영자는 깨끗한 커뮤니티 공간을 만드는 것이 1순위입니다.
수정하기
취소하기